> Throw exception which region is closing or splitting when delete data
> ---------------------------------------------------------------------

> Currently delete data is UngroupedAggregateRegionObserver class  on server 
> side, this class check if isRegionClosingOrSplitting is true. when 
> isRegionClosingOrSplitting is true, will throw new IOException("Temporarily 
> unable to write from scan because region is closing or splitting"). 
> when region online , which initialize phoenix CP that 
> isRegionClosingOrSplitting  is false.before region split, region change  
> isRegionClosingOrSplitting to true.but if region split failed,split will roll 
> back where not change   isRegionClosingOrSplitting  to false. after that all 
> write  opration will always throw exception which is Temporarily unable to 
> write from scan because region is closing or splitting。
> so we should change isRegionClosingOrSplitting   to false  when region 
> preRollBackSplit in UngroupedAggregateRegionObserver class。
> A simple test where a data table split failed, then roll back success.but 
> delete data always throw exception.
>  # create data table 
>  # bulkload data for this table
>  # alter hbase-server code, which region split will throw exception , then 
> rollback.
>  # use hbase shell , split region
>  # view regionserver log, where region split failed, and then rollback 
> success.
>  # user phoenix sqlline.py for delete data, which  will throw exption
